Abstract

A non-equal granularity light-tree (NeGLt) which supports the user-desired spectrum allocation is designed for multicast flow aggregation (MFA) scheme. Simulations show that NeGLt-MFA can greatly reduce spectrum consumption and has an extensive application scope.
